Buying Guide for Bluetooth for Aux Port

Understanding Bluetooth for Aux Port

When I first looked into adding Bluetooth functionality to my car or home audio system, I realized that a Bluetooth aux adapter is a simple device that plugs into the aux port of any speaker or stereo. This allows wireless streaming from my phone or other Bluetooth-enabled devices. Knowing this helped me decide that I needed a convenient way to enjoy music without replacing my entire audio setup.

Compatibility with Your Device

One of the first things I checked was whether the Bluetooth adapter was compatible with my existing aux port. Since aux ports are standard 3.5mm jacks, most adapters fit seamlessly. However, I made sure to verify if my stereo or car system’s aux port supports audio input and not just output, to avoid any issues.

Bluetooth Version and Range

I found that the Bluetooth version is important because newer versions offer better sound quality, faster pairing, and improved battery efficiency. For my needs, I looked for adapters with at least Bluetooth 4.0 or higher. Also, the effective range mattered since I wanted to keep my phone in my pocket or bag while streaming music without interruptions.

Power Source and Battery Life

Since these adapters need power, I considered how they are powered. Some plug into USB ports, while others come with rechargeable batteries. I preferred rechargeable models because they offered portability and avoided clutter from extra cables. Checking the battery life was crucial for me to ensure uninterrupted use during long drives or sessions.

Audio Quality

Audio quality can vary between adapters. I looked for devices that support advanced audio codecs like aptX or AAC, which provide better sound fidelity over Bluetooth. This was important to me as I wanted my music to sound clear and rich without noticeable lag or distortion.

Ease of Use and Features

I appreciated adapters that were easy to set up with straightforward pairing processes. Additional features like built-in microphones for hands-free calls, volume controls, or multi-device pairing were bonuses that enhanced my overall experience. These extras made the device more versatile and user-friendly.

Price and Warranty

Lastly, I balanced the price with the features offered. I didn’t want to overspend, but I also avoided the cheapest options that might compromise quality. Checking for warranty and customer support gave me peace of mind in case the adapter had any issues down the line.
